Eskimos trim roster by two

September 19, 2007 - Canadian Football League (CFL)
Edmonton Elks News Release


Edmonton) The Edmonton Eskimos today released a pair of first year players - import OL Tony Tella and non-import DB Jeremy Steeves. Tella appeared in two games, while Steeves was in the Eskimo line-up for four games.

The Edmonton Eskimo Football Club is one of the most successful teams in CFL history with 13 Grey Cup championships and a North American pro-sports record of 34 consecutive years in the playoffs. A community-owned team, the Eskimos pride themselves on giving back to the community that has supported the organization throughout its illustrious history.
